Pro-Ject Xtension 9 Evolution Turntable

Limited inventory. Available at Vinyl Sound in Toronto, Canada, the Pro-Ject Xtension 9 Evolution is a high-end belt-drive turntable that distils over two decades of Pro-Ject engineering into a compact, rack-friendly form. Weighing 16kg (35 lbs), it combines two of the most effective approaches to vinyl playback — mass loading and suspended isolation — in a single chassis. Every Xtension 9 Evolution is handmade in Europe, ships with the EVO 9 CC 9" carbon fiber tonearm, quartz-regulated electronic speed control, an 800g record puck, and a dust cover. Steel-Pellet MDF Plinth — Mass Loading Done Right

The Xtension 9 Evolution's plinth is CNC-machined from high-density MDF — a naturally resonance-absorbing material — and filled at its central gravity point with steel pellets. Unlike a solid metal insert, which can develop its own resonances, loose steel pellets dissipate vibration energy through dispersion. This draws harmful resonance away from the bearing and tonearm, dramatically reducing the potential for plinth-borne noise to colour the signal. The resulting mass (16kg total) also provides the inertial stability that characterises the best high-end turntable designs.

Opposing-Magnetic Isolation Feet

The main plinth sits on three opposing-magnetic isolation feet that physically decouple it from whatever surface the turntable rests on. With opposing magnets in each foot, the entire 16kg plinth effectively floats — combining the noise-rejection of a suspension design with the inertial stability of mass loading. A reviewer who tested the table noted that knocking the support surface caused no stylus skip whatsoever, a direct result of this dual-principle isolation.

TPE-Damped Platter on Inverted Ceramic Bearing

Pro-Ject's platter uses a precision aluminum alloy damped with a ring of thermoplastic elastomer (TPE) on the underside, topped with a layer of recycled vinyl baked into the surface as an integrated mat. The entire sandwich is precision-balanced before installation. The platter spins on an inverted ceramic ball-and-plate bearing supported by an additional opposing-magnetic force — the magnetic assist reduces the effective weight on the bearing surface to near zero, eliminating bearing friction and rumble at the source.

Quartz-Regulated Electronic Speed Control

Speed accuracy is handled by quartz-generated electronic regulation with microprocessor control — the same Speed Box technology Pro-Ject uses in their standalone speed control units. Clean, interference-free AC power is generated on-board and fed directly to the synchronous motor, decoupling it from mains noise. Speed variance is held to ±0.09% and wow and flutter to ±0.1%. Switching between 33 and 45rpm requires only a button press.

Balanced Output — True Reference Operation

The Xtension 9 Evolution ships with a 5-pin DIN to RCA phono cable for standard unbalanced use, but its 5-pin DIN output supports full balanced operation via an optional DIN-to-XLR or DIN-to-mini-XLR cable paired with a balanced phono stage. Running balanced eliminates common-mode noise across the phono cable run and represents a meaningful sonic upgrade — one that typically requires far more expensive components from other manufacturers. Technical Specifications

Specification Value
Drive principle Belt drive
Speeds 33 / 45 rpm (electronic switching)
Speed variance (max) ±0.09%
Wow and flutter (max) ±0.1%
Signal to noise ratio 73dB
Tonearm included EVO 9 CC (9" one-piece carbon fiber armtube)
Effective tonearm length 230mm (9")
Effective tonearm mass 8.5g
Overhang 16mm
Tonearm cable capacitance 65pF/m
Phono output Balanced 5-pin DIN (ships with DIN > RCA cable)
Power supply External 15V DC universal (outboard)
Power consumption 4W / 0W standby
Total weight 16kg / 35 lbs
Origin Handmade in Europe

What is the advantage of the steel-pellet-filled plinth over a solid metal chassis?

A solid metal insert can develop its own resonant frequency and ring. Loose steel pellets, by contrast, dissipate vibrational energy through movement and friction between individual pellets — a dispersion effect that converts mechanical energy to heat rather than allowing it to resonate. Pro-Ject uses this same approach across their RPM 9, RPM 10, and Signature series plinths.

How does balanced operation improve sound on the Xtension 9 Evolution?

In balanced mode, the phono signal travels from the tonearm through the cable as a differential pair. Any noise picked up along the cable length is common to both conductors and cancelled at the balanced input of the phono stage — a process called common-mode rejection. The result is a lower noise floor, improved channel separation, and greater dynamic range. You need an MC cartridge, a balanced DIN cable, and a phono stage with balanced inputs to use this feature.

Can the tonearm on the Xtension 9 Evolution be upgraded?

Yes. The Xtension 9 Evolution accepts drop-in tonearm upgrades with no soldering required. Options include the EVO 9 CA Premium (carbon/aluminum armtube, silver tonearm wire, upgraded bearings, TPE-damped counterweight), and the EVO AS and EVO AS Premium curved arms with replaceable headshells — ideal for cartridge collectors.
